Physical properties

Coarse-grained, speckled pink, white, gray, and black appearance; vitreous quartz and feldspar luster, interlocking crystals, no obvious cleavage as a whole, Mohs hardness about 6–7, specific gravity 2.63–2.75.

Formation & geological history

An intrusive felsic igneous rock formed when silica-rich magma cooled slowly deep underground, allowing large crystals to grow; typically Precambrian to Phanerozoic in age. The rounded shape indicates stream or beach abrasion, or tumbling.

Uses & applications

Widely used for building stone, countertops, monuments, paving, aggregate, and landscaping; polished pieces are popular as decorative and educational specimens.

Geological facts

Pink coloration commonly comes from potassium feldspar, while dark minerals are biotite or amphibole. Granite is the coarse-grained equivalent of rhyolite.

Field identification & locations

Identify it by visible interlocking crystals of pink feldspar, translucent gray quartz, and black mica/amphibole; it is commonly found in continental shields, mountain batholiths, river gravels, and glacial deposits.
